Are Indrapr.Medical latest results good or bad?

Indraprastha Medical's latest financial results for Q2 FY26 reflect a mixed operational performance. The company reported net sales of ₹365.06 crores, representing a sequential growth of 9.38% from the previous quarter, although year-on-year growth moderated to 4.94%. This indicates a deceleration in revenue momentum compared to previous periods.Net profit for the quarter stood at ₹51.46 crores, showing a quarter-on-quarter increase of 14.95% and a year-on-year growth of 14.94%. The operating margin improved to 20.04%, up 167 basis points from the prior quarter, highlighting effective cost management and operational efficiency. However, on a year-on-year basis, the operating margin contracted slightly, suggesting some volatility in profitability.
The company's return on equity (ROE) was reported at 28.10%, which is significantly above the historical average, indicating strong capital efficiency. Furthermore, the company operates with a debt-free balance sheet, maintaining a net cash position, which provides strategic flexibility for future investments.
Despite the positive aspects of the latest results, the year-on-year revenue growth rate has moderated compared to the double-digit growth seen in prior quarters, raising some concerns about sustainability. Additionally, the company has seen a slight decline in institutional participation, with foreign institutional investor holdings decreasing marginally.
Overall, Indraprastha Medical's performance illustrates a company that is managing to expand its profitability and maintain operational efficiency, yet it faces challenges in sustaining revenue growth momentum.
